ds_grid_read

This function can be used to convert a string which has been created previously by the function ds_grid_write() back into a DS grid. The DS grid must have been created previously (see the example below).

Note that if the specified DS string was written by the GameMaker: Studio 1.2.x runtime (or older), you should specify the optional argument "legacy", setting it to true as the string format changed after that.

 

Syntax:

ds_grid_read(index, string [, legacy]);

Argument Type Description
index DS Grid The index of the grid to read.
string String The string to read into the DS grid.
legacy Boolean OPTIONAL Can be either true or false or omitted completely.

 

Returns:

N/A

 

Example:

grid = ds_grid_create(room_width div 32, room_height div 32);
ini_open("Save.ini");
ds_grid_read(grid, ini_read_string("Save", "0", ""));
ini_close();

The above code creates a DS grid based on the size of the room (each 32x32 square of pixels represents one grid cell) and then reads a previously saved set of grid data from an ini file into the new DS grid.
